Student of the Month - December 2007

Thanks For Your Support

My name is Jordan and I am 16 years old. I’m from Portage County and have been at Rawhide six months. My favorite things to do include working on my dad’s old pickup truck and playing football and basketball. I also enjoy Coach Andy Schroeder’s (academic instructor) social studies class and Scott Wilson’s (academic instructor) math class. I hope to attend a course at Fox Valley Technical College in Appleton and get a commercial driver’s license so I can drive truck. One of my goals in life is to be a positive influence on my younger brothers and sisters. I have four brothers, one sister, a step-brother, and a step-sister.

I would like to thank Angel Williams (senior resident instructor) for all his support. When I first came to Rawhide I didn’t plan on staying; but as he spent time taking me around the ranch and talking to me about his past, I chose not to leave. It really stopped me in my tracks––everything that he told me proved you can change and break your old habits. Throughout the past six months, I’ve been trying to meet my program goals and am doing pretty well. I’m starting to see my family more and spend time in the community.

I have learned that you can’t do whatever you feel like doing; it is better to think about it and make wise choices. With Rawhide’s help, I now can look forward to a bright future.

~Jordan
